Tips for Optimal Radiant Heater Installation

Installing a radiant heater, whether for indoor or outdoor use, requires careful planning to maximize its energy efficiency, thermal comfort, and durability. Here is a detailed guide to help you through each step of the installation, from initial choices to final implementation.

1. Choose the Right Location

The placement of radiant heaters plays a crucial role in their performance. Poor placement can lead to cold spots or energy waste. Here’s how to choose the ideal location:

For indoors:

  • Ceiling or wall: Ceiling-mounted panels distribute heat evenly across the room, while wall-mounted ones target specific areas.
  • Proximity to occupied areas: Place heaters near areas where you spend the most time (sofas, dining table, desk).
  • Avoid obstacles: Ensure that no furniture or curtains block the infrared radiation to guarantee optimal heat distribution.

For outdoors:

  • Sheltered areas: Install devices in partially protected spaces, such as under a pergola or awning, to limit heat loss due to wind.
  • Strategic positioning: Aim heaters to cover areas where people gather, such as around a table or lounge area.
  • Installation height: Mount the devices at an appropriate height for even heat distribution (typically between 2.5m and 3.5m).

2. Select the Right Type of Radiant Heater

The choice of heater type depends on several factors, including space size, intended use, and environmental conditions.

Indoor options:

  • Wall or ceiling-mounted panels: Ideal for living rooms, bathrooms, and bedrooms.
  • Portable infrared heaters: Perfect for occasional use in specific areas.
  • Built-in heaters: For discreet and aesthetic integration.

Outdoor options:

  • Fixed electric heaters: Practical for permanent installation on terraces or balconies.
  • Portable heaters: Ideal for adjusting heat as needed or moving the devices between different areas.
  • Hybrid solar models: A sustainable and cost-effective solution, perfect for semi-open spaces.

3. Consider Power and Thermal Coverage

The power of the radiant heater must be suited to the space size and specific conditions (indoor or outdoor).

Power calculation:

  • Indoors: Count around 100 W/m² for a well-insulated space. In less insulated rooms, plan for between 125 and 150 W/m².
  • Outdoors: The required power depends on wind exposure and ambient temperatures. Generally, a power of 250 to 400 W/m² is recommended for outdoor areas.

Heat distribution:

  • Use multiple low-power devices distributed evenly rather than a single high-power device. This avoids cold and overheated zones.
  • Check the diffusion angle to cover the desired space effectively.

4. Install Devices Safely

Respect safety distances:

  • Maintain a minimum distance between the heater and flammable objects (furniture, curtains, etc.). This distance is generally indicated in the manufacturer's manual.
  • Avoid installing devices too close to occupants to prevent excessive heat.

Solid mounting:

  • For wall or ceiling devices, use mountings suited to the weight and structure of the wall/ceiling.
  • For portable devices, ensure they are stable to prevent accidental tipping.

Protection from weather:

  • For outdoor installations, choose devices with an appropriate IP (Ingress Protection) rating. For example, an IP44 or higher guarantees protection from water splashes.
  • If possible, install a roof or shelter to extend the lifespan of the devices.

5. Integrate Smart Control Systems

Modern radiant heaters often offer advanced control options to improve efficiency and ease of use.

Smart thermostats:

  • Set the temperature according to occupancy times to avoid waste.
  • Some models allow remote control via a mobile app.

Presence sensors:

  • These sensors detect movement and activate the heater only when people are present, reducing energy costs.

Thermal zoning:

  • Divide your space into distinct zones, each equipped with its own heater and thermostat. This allows heating only the necessary areas.

6. Optimize Insulation and Environmental Conditions

Indoors:

  • Improve insulation of walls, windows, and floors to minimize heat loss.
  • Use thermal rugs or curtains to retain heat.

Outdoors:

  • Install windbreaks or transparent panels around heated areas to limit heat dissipation.
  • Add decorative elements like outdoor rugs or insulating furniture to enhance thermal comfort.

7. Maintain and Service Your Radiant Heaters

Regular maintenance extends the lifespan of the devices and maintains their efficiency.

For electric devices:

  • Clean the surfaces of the radiant panels to remove dust and debris that may reduce efficiency.
  • Regularly check cables and connections for signs of wear.

For gas or solar devices:

  • Inspect gas lines for leaks.
  • Clean solar panels to ensure maximum energy absorption.
